With the development of wireless networks and improvement of hardware integration, wireless sensor network is now widely used. As a concrete example of a wireless sensor network, wireless body area network, has a huge demand in the modern health care systems and disease prevention mechanism.Because of the potential effects of radiation, for many people, the radio signal will not be accepted. Ultrasound as a transmission medium of communication for the wireless signal will make wireless body area network much more acceptable for its harmless to human body. Since the strong directional propagation of ultrasonic waves, the original radio signal propagation model and route algorithm is not suitable for transmission control of the ultrasonic signal. Besides, the variability of topology, the complexity of human surface and the movement of human also lead to great difficulties for the information reliable transmission in wireless body area network.As a fusing of coding technique and routing information exchange strategy, network coding has a great advantage in increasing network throughput, improving load balance, reducing the transmission delay, saving node energy, enhancing the robustness and reliability of the network. Therefore, introducing the technique of network coding to wireless body area network is very necessary to improve the reliability of data transmission.Since the energy restrictions of each node in WSN, the life cycle of wireless sensor networks has been a hot research topic. Since the energy consumption of spreading information in the wireless sensor network is the largest contributor to the total energy consumption, thus reducing energy consumption in information dissemination area is one of the best way to prolong the network life cycle. Similarly, for wireless body area network, routing algorithm with energy saving feature is also one of the ways to extend the life cycle.In this paper, based on the ultrasonic signal transmission mode, according to data transmission problem in body area network, research on how to improve the reliability of communication and prolong the network life cycle. By using network coding algorithm on the relay nodes to improve the reliability of wireless body area network data transmission; Through dynamic routing policy to save energy and prolong the life cycle of wireless body area network. Finally the correctness of network coding algorithm and routing algorithm are both verified by experiment, and through comparing with the existing algorithm, the improvement of network life cycle and network reliability are also illustrated intuitively.
